How Much Does 500g Of Chicken Breast Weigh In Pounds?

How much does 500g of chicken breast weigh in pounds?

To determine the weight of 500g of chicken breast in pounds, it’s essential to know that 1 pound is equivalent to approximately 453.592 grams. Therefore, to convert 500g to pounds, you can divide 500 by 453.592. Performing the calculation: 500g / 453.592g/lb ≈ 1.10231 pounds. So, 500g of chicken breast weighs approximately 1.1 pounds. When cooking or following a recipe, understanding these conversions can be crucial for achieving the right proportions and flavors. For instance, if a recipe calls for 1 pound of chicken breast, you can use 500g as a close substitute, keeping in mind that it’s slightly over the required amount. This conversion is especially useful for those who prefer using metric measurements in their daily cooking but need to adapt to imperial system requirements.

What is the conversion rate between grams and pounds?

To understand the conversion rate between grams and pounds, it’s essential to grasp the fundamental relationship between these two units of mass. The conversion rate is fixed at 1 pound = 453.592 grams. This means if you need to convert grams to pounds, you divide the number of grams by 453.592. For instance, if you have 907.184 grams and want to convert it to pounds, you simply divide 907.184 by 453.592 to get 2 pounds. Conversely, to convert pounds to grams, multiply the number of pounds by 453.592.

How many pounds are in a kilogram of chicken breast?

When cooking or meal planning, it’s often necessary to convert between units of measurement, such as switching from kilograms to pounds. To determine how many pounds are in a kilogram of chicken breast, we can rely on a simple conversion factor. One kilogram is equivalent to 2.20462 pounds. So, if you’re working with a kilogram of chicken breast, you can expect it to weigh approximately 2.2 pounds. This conversion is particularly useful when following recipes that use different units of measurement or when purchasing chicken breast in bulk. For example, if a recipe calls for 1 pound of chicken breast, you can calculate that you need roughly 0.45 kilograms (or 450 grams) to meet the requirement. Being able to convert between kilograms and pounds can help streamline your meal planning and cooking process.

Can I use ounces instead of pounds when converting measurements?

Weight conversions can be a daunting task, especially when working with recipes from different regions or cookbooks. One common question that arises is whether you can use ounces instead of pounds when converting measurements. The answer is yes, but it’s essential to understand the conversion factors to ensure accuracy. One pound is equivalent to 16 ounces, so if a recipe calls for 1/4 pound of an ingredient, you can easily substitute it with 4 ounces. This comes in handy when working with ingredients like cheese, nuts, or chocolate, where precision is crucial. By making this simple conversion, you can avoid tedious calculations and ensure your dishes turn out as intended. Additionally, using ounces can be beneficial when working with smaller quantities, as it allows for more precise measurements, which can be particularly important in baking.

Does the weight of the chicken breast affect cooking time?

When it comes to cooking chicken breast, the weight of the meat can play a significant role in determining the optimal cooking time. Generally, a thicker and heavier chicken breast will require more time to cook through to ensure food safety and achieve that juicy, tender texture that many of us love. A good rule of thumb is to cook thick chicken breasts for around 20-25 minutes, or until they reach an internal temperature of 165°F (74°C), while smaller breasts can be cooked for around 15-20 minutes. However, it’s essential to note that the weight of the chicken breast can also affect the evenness of cooking, with heavier breasts potentially being more prone to overcooking on the outside by the time the inside is fully cooked. To combat this, consider using a meat thermometer to monitor the internal temperature, and adjust your cooking time accordingly. Additionally, consider tenderizing the breast with a marinade or brine before cooking to help ensure even cooking and a more tender final product.
